11/28/22 – This is an excellent example of rare .22 Caliber Walther PPK, manufactured in 1939. The gun is all matching and has the proper “Crown N” commercial proofs. It comes as a rig with a nice period-correct chocolate leather Akah holster and two period-correct magazines – one has a finger extension bottom. The gun itself has retained about 96-97% of its original high polish finish. The majority of the wear is around the muzzle, but there is also some very light wear along both sides of the slide. A couple of small areas of very light pin-pricking on the left side of the slide. Comes with an excellent brown Walther grip – no cracks or chips. Mint bore.
